In hubs like Tullamarine and Dandenong, massive warehouses storing combustible materials require high-flow split-case diesel fire pumps. Our NFPA 20 standard 1000m3/h pumps are ideal for these scenarios, providing the massive water volume needed for ESFR (Early Suppression, Fast Response) sprinkler systems.
For properties on the outskirts of Melbourne—such as the Yarra Valley or the Mornington Peninsula—fire safety is a seasonal necessity. Our portable and stationary diesel-driven fire pumps provide an independent water source for perimeter drenching systems, crucial when electric power is compromised during bushfire events.
Melbourne’s world-class hospitals (like the Royal Melbourne or Monash Health) require the highest level of redundancy. Our EDJ systems provide triple-layer protection: the Electric pump for primary response, the Diesel pump as an autonomous backup, and the Jockey pump to prevent unnecessary full-system starts by maintaining static pressure.
